Al Nuaimiya is one of Ajman's most established, centrally located, and densely populated residential and commercial districts, sitting between Al Rashidiya and Ajman's industrial sectors, right on the Ajman–Sharjah border. It's known for its genuinely mixed housing stock: older, smaller villas tucked into quieter internal streets, low-rise buildings, and a skyline of modern high-rise towers alongside strong day-to-day commercial activity.
The area is organised into three sub-communities, Al Nuaimiya 1, Al Nuaimiya 2, and Al Nuaimiya 3, running east to west and served by four main roads: King Faisal Street, College Street, Sheikh Jaber Al-Sabah Street, and Sheikh Khalifa Bin Zayed Street. Al Nuaimiya is served by four main roads: King Faisal Street, College Street, Sheikh Jaber Al-Sabah Street, and Sheikh Khalifa Bin Zayed Street, with the latter conveniently linking to Al Ittihad Street (E11) for smooth commuting to Sharjah and Dubai. Public transport is genuinely strong for an Ajman district, with buses including AJ2, AJ3, AJ6, UAQ, and DXB1 serving the area, and many buildings within walking distance of a bus stop. Ajman itself has no metro system, but the E400 bus service connects to Dubai's metro network, including Dubai Airport Free Zone Metro Station and Al Nahda Metro Station.
Al Nuaimiya has a strong concentration of schools, including Al Ameer English School, Al Shola Private School, Ajman Academy, Indian School Ajman, and The Bloomington Academy, with British International School located specifically within Al Nuaimiya 3, giving families in-district access without a suburban drive.
Thumbay Hospital serves the wider Al Nuaimiya area, with dedicated bus stops named Ajman Thumbay Hospital 1 and Ajman Thumbay Hospital 2 within Al Nuaimiya 1, reflecting how central this facility is to the district.
Al Nuaimiya has excellent shopping access, including Safeer Mall, Galleria Mall, and Dana Mall, alongside Ajman City Centre, a short drive away. Restaurants such as Khaja Restaurant and Altekia Restaurant serve the local community, alongside numerous smaller cafés, supermarkets, and everyday retail woven throughout the district.
Al Nuaimiya has a genuine hotel presence, including the Crown Palace Hotel and Suites Ajman and the Ramada Hotel & Suites by Wyndham, reflecting the area's central, well-connected position.
Residents have access to Hamidiya Park, Rashideya Ladies Park, Ajman Museum, and the Al Zorah Natural Reserve within reach, as well as Ajman Beach and the Corniche, a short drive away.

Al Nuaimiya offers one of the broadest and most varied property mixes in Ajman, a genuine spread of older villas, low-rise buildings, and modern high-rise towers, with apartments dominating the overall market.
Apartments are the dominant property type in Al Nuaimiya, ranging from studios through to 3-bedroom units, across a mix of older mid-rise blocks and newer high-rise developments. Notable high-rise buildings in the area include the 32-storey Ajman Twin Towers, the 28-storey Al Anwar Tower, the 26-storey Sky Tower, the 22-storey Al Ghumlasi Tower 1, and the 20-storey Twin Complex, among others. Studio apartments have been reported to rent for as little as AED 10k per year, with sale prices for some entry-level units starting in a similarly accessible range, making Al Nuaimiya one of Ajman's most affordable central locations for apartment living.
While apartments dominate, select pockets of villas exist throughout Al Nuaimiya, particularly along quieter internal streets away from the main roads. Many of these are older, established homes rather than newly built developments, suiting families who want more space in a genuinely central location. Villas closer to main roads or commercial zones generally command higher rents than those tucked into residential side streets.
Alongside its high-rise towers, Al Nuaimiya has a significant stock of smaller, low-rise apartment buildings, particularly in the district's older parts. These buildings often have fewer amenities than newer towers; older buildings in particular don't always offer dedicated parking, with residents relying on street parking instead.
